Bill Russell vs Oscar Robertson

Bill Russell and Oscar Robertson were contemporaries, their careers overlapping for 9 seasons. On the floor, Oscar Robertson was the higher-volume scorer (25.7 points per game to 15.1); Oscar Robertson was the more efficient scorer (56.4% true shooting to 47.1%); Oscar Robertson created more for others (9.5 assists per game to 4.3). Bill Russell holds the edge on accolades — 5 MVPs, 11 championships and the #5 all-time ranking to Oscar Robertson's #26.
